Sambhal (Uttar Pradesh):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Monday laid the foundation stone of Shri Kalki Dham temple here in Sambhal.

PM Modi also unveiled a model of the temple. He was accompanied by Uttar Pradesh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ath and Kalki Dham Peethadheeshwar Acharya Pramod Krishnam. 

The Prime Minister said that Kalki Dham temple will have 10 Garbh Grah with 10 avatars of God.

The Shri Kalki Dham is being constructed by the Shri Kalki Dham Nirman Trust. 

The programme was attended by several seers and religious leaders from across the country. 

The Kalki Dham Temple: 
The Kalki Dham Temple is dedicated to Lord Kalki who is Lord Vidhnu's tenth incarnation. This temple is considered to be the world's most special temple because it is said to be the first 'Dham' where God's temple was established before his incarnation.

This Temple will be constructed over a five-acre land and is expected to take about five years for the construction to be completed. The common factor between this temple and the Ayodhya Ram Mandir and Somnath Temple, is that all three are being constructed using the same pink-coloured stone. 

The architecture ‘shaili’ is also the same and therefore no steel or iron frames will be used in its construction. The ‘shikhara’ of the temple will be 108 ft high and its platform will be build 11 feet above. (Agencies)
